SJC was a total nightmare today. I waited 30 minutes to get into the first class line. Then I waited 1.5 hours to get my bag checked in the first class line. There were 2 ticket agents for 1 of those hours. The main cabin line was moving at 3X the spead.
I was sweating and panicing the whole time. The Airport was a complete parking lot. After checking in they wanted me to wait in a security line for another 30 minutes. That would have put me on the plane 20 minutes after take off. Luckily some nice supurvisor let me cut, but boy...
Got in my seat and noticed my bag still wasn't on the plane (I was sitting right above the forward bag hold when they closed it). Right before we pulled out a tuck showed up with about 40 additional bags for all the folks who, like myself, didn't think 2 hours wasn't enough.
Here I was thinking I was going to go relax in the lounge after my quick 10 minute wait in line. Well, what I got was a few heart attacks thinking what would happen if I missed my flight. Thank god I made it home, but shame on American for:
1) not telling me that I should camp out at the checkin line the night before
2) properly staffing the first class line
3) Dealing with the crouds. At one point there was a single line for people checking in, first class, security, and even people trying to leave the airport. And we just had to stand and wait. Actually, it won't be bump vouchers. Too many people have not been able to clear check-in or security in time to make their flights, so there have been lots of No-Shows. They will get accommodated on later flights when space opens up on those flights. The real nightmare will be for the gate agents who have to close the flights later in the day, dealing with standbys while also knowing that many of their No-Shows are probably still lined up somewhere in the terminal. They will eventually arrive, upset having missed their flight, and joining the waitlist cue for the next flights out.
